Tennent's Visitor Centre

Wellpark Brewery in Glasgow is home to more than 450 years of brewing tradition and award winning beers. Our new tour takes you behind the scenes to discover how we make Tennent's so special.

We've been part of Scotland and its culture for generations. This is a chance to learn about the rich heritage of one of the country's most loved brands as well as about the production processes that have taken place at Wellpark from through the centuries up to today. Follow us from the very origins of brewing at Wellpark, to present day support of and passion for Scottish music and football. As well as a rare collection of vintage and retro Tennent's packaging, there's a chance to watch your favourite Tennent's adverts from over the decades and also a shop to buy exclusive Tennent's goodies... And to top it all off, there might even be a cheeky wee taste of Scotland's Favourite at the end of the tour in it for you. Tasty.

Experience Highlights

Tennent's is a beer with more than a century of history . It's based in Glasgow at the Wellpark Brewery, just a short walk from the Necropolis and the city centre. On this tour you will meet a local guide who will explain how the amber-coloured liquid is distilled and the history of the brand. At the end of the tour you can enjoy a pint of beer, which is included in the price. In total, the tour lasts about an hour and a half .

The star product is Tennent's Super , a beer with a market share of almost 50% in Scotland. It is a strong, golden yellow lager with a pleasant malty and apple aroma and no bitter notes. Local ingredients, such as Highland water from Loch Katrine, are used to achieve this fresh taste.

The birth of the brand dates back to 1556 , when Robert Tennent founded a craft brewery in Glasgow. Two centuries later, in 1769, his heirs moved the brewery to its present location, while in 1876 the iconic red 'T' , the logo still in use today, was registered . Few brands have survived the centuries and two world wars and have become a true icon of Scotland around the world.
